    Copy-Paste Prompt
    You are a fine motor skills specialist tasked with creating an engaging workshop for a group of experienced jewelers. The goal is to refine their dexterous abilities while working on intricate jewelry-making tasks.

    Generate a detailed plan that includes the following elements:

    - Workshop Objective: Clearly define the desired outcomes and skill levels targeted by this session.
    - Participant Assessment: Outline a method for evaluating participants' current fine motor skills to ensure appropriate workshop difficulty.
    - Exercise Selection: Suggest three unique exercises that cater to various learning styles (visual, kinesthetic, auditory) and align with the skill levels of your team.
    - Materials & Tools Required: List all necessary materials and tools needed for each exercise, including any specialized equipment or safety precautions.
    - Visual Aids & Demonstrations: Propose ways to incorporate visual aids (e.g., diagrams, videos) and live demonstrations to enhance understanding and retention of techniques.
    - Assessment Methods: Provide two methods for assessing participants' progress throughout the workshop, ensuring consistent evaluation across all attendees.

    Copy-Paste Prompt
    Given an existing fine motor coordination exercise designed for beginners (e.g., thread looping), adapt it to better suit the skill level of experienced jewelers.

    Modify the exercise by considering these aspects:

    - Difficulty Level: Increase the complexity and precision required, such as incorporating additional steps or requiring greater speed.
    - Tools & Materials: Introduce advanced tools or materials that challenge participants without compromising safety (e.g., switching from regular wire to finer gauge).
    - Feedback Methods: Develop more specific feedback techniques tailored to the nuances of an experienced audience, focusing on areas for improvement rather than basic technique.
    - Visual & Kinesthetic Aids: Incorporate advanced visual aids or kinesthetic experiences that enhance understanding and engagement among experts.
